有自己教小朋友编程的吗 - V2EX
V2EX = way to explore
V2EX 是一个关于分享和探索的地方
现在注册
已注册用户请  登录
Great Sources
TED
vicalloy
V2EX    教育

有自己教小朋友编程的吗

  •  
  •   vicalloy 2025 年 2 月 19 日 3530 次点击
    这是一个创建于 344 天前的主题,其中的信息可能已经有所发展或是发生改变。
    不知道小朋友自己是否感兴趣,如果感兴趣打算自己来教。
    初步打算先教一些计算机常识,然后教一些 python 语法,再用 pygame 写个简单的游戏。
    不知道有没有合适的教材推荐。
    第 1 条附言    2025 年 2 月 20 日
    是三年级的小朋友了。编程在我看来更多的是一种技能,和开发智力没多少关系,因此一直没有教过。
    同时编程又有些类似乐高,用一些组件搭建自己的玩具,因此编程本身是一件有意思的事情(我自己从小喜欢编程)。
    小朋友学校有信息课(打字),学校也有些编程相关的兴趣班。想着让别人教不如自己教的原则,打算尝试一下。不感兴趣就算了,毕竟编程仅仅是种技能,没必要以功利的心态来看待。
    37 条回复    2025-02-20 21:03:12 +08:00
    geeksnail
        1
    geeksnail  
       2025 年 2 月 19 日   1
    小孩还小的话,不如手机上装个 scratchjr ,看看小孩有没有兴趣。
    n2l
        2
    n2l  
       2025 年 2 月 19 日 via iPhone
    大哥,绕了孩子吧,天真烂漫的年龄,搞这些个东西。
    vicalloy
        3
    vicalloy  
    OP
       2025 年 2 月 19 日 via iPhone   2
    @n2l 小朋友想学就学,不想学就算了。没必要这么激动
    loading
        4
    loading  
       2025 年 2 月 19 日
    小朋友几岁,没到五年级真的没必要入门。
    crysislinux
        5
    crysislinux  
       2025 年 2 月 19 日 via Android
    感觉还是搞个硬件来控制更有趣吧。尤其是比较低龄的小朋友
    prosgtsr
        6
    prosgtsr  
       2025 年 2 月 19 日 via iPhone
    玩游戏的话从游戏 mod 开始?
    plucury
        7
    plucury  
       2025 年 2 月 19 日
    推荐 Micro:bit
    lekai63
        8
    lekai63  
       2025 年 2 月 19 日 via iPhone
    我家 2 年级。

    从五岁开始玩我的世界。现在能用红石搭建一些机关。 编程还没学。

    学校连除法都没学呢,学编程 是想教啥呢?

    if else while 之类 成年人一天掌握的东西 没必要折腾一个童年吧。

    算法的话,除法 分数 都没学,质数啥的概念更不用说了,矩阵运算自己都算不明白呢。密码学、AI 的基础知识也不够用啊。

    我简单教了下二进制:满十进一是他学校学的。那满八进一,满二进一呢?再来个满十六进一呢。 他有点懵的,满 16 进一 他问我那怎么用一个符号表示 10 11 呢 反正我测出来 不是数学天才
    XuHuan1025
        9
    XuHuan1025  
       2025 年 2 月 19 日
    不如画画乐器 编程啥时候学都不玩
    WorseIsBetter
        10
    WorseIsBetter  
       2025 年 2 月 19 日
    如果是非常小的孩子的话,不如先给他推荐几个锻炼逻辑思维能力的解谜类游戏(比如 Zachtronics 家的 Opus Magnum 就是一个不错的选择)。如果他感兴趣,能玩得下去,这时候再让他接触 real-world programming 也不迟。

    一上来就灌输冷冰冰的理论知识,可能反而会打击其对计算机相关领域的兴趣(回想起我小时候,家里让我练吉他,搞得手指千疮百孔。现在一看见吉他,手就开始隐隐作痛)
    root71370
        11
    root71370  
       2025 年 2 月 19 日 via Android
    先从遥控车搞起来
    levelworm
        12
    levelworm  
       2025 年 2 月 20 日 via Android
    @lekai63
    确定?

    他有点懵的,满 16 进一 他问我那怎么用一个符号表示 10 11 呢

    我擦,这是很完美的逻辑思维啊。2 年级能想到这个,不简单。我儿子四岁半了,还只能加一,加二就不行了。
    datocp
        13
    datocp  
       2025 年 2 月 20 日 via Android   1
    我们这里的小学也有类似这个名字 ScratchJr 的 pc 版,一家美国大学出的,不知道是必修课还是兴趣小组。
    其它的就是乐高机器人

    我们那时候是在小霸王玩 basic ,
    levelworm
        14
    levelworm  
       2025 年 2 月 20 日 via Android
    @datocp #13
    感觉还是 BASIC 好,文字编程,没有其他选择,一下就把对编程没有比较大兴趣的小孩过滤了,省的家长折腾。
    Fule
        15
    Fule  
       2025 年 2 月 20 日
    上小学了的话,可以试试 https://code.org
    csuzhangxc
        16
    csuzhangxc  
       2025 年 2 月 20 日 via Android   1
    我老婆正在做这个尝试。小孩自己对编程有兴趣,试了一些机构的体验课,感觉太嗦了,干脆就自己搞了

    广告: https://space.bilibili.com/103304976
    hefish
        17
    hefish  
       2025 年 2 月 20 日
    少儿编程屁用没有。 我觉着还是搞点航空航天,动物植物,历史故事之类的
    nanrenlei
        18
    nanrenlei  
       2025 年 2 月 20 日
    有啊,要看孩子兴趣,有人孩子五年级已经刷算法了
    simpleman
        19
    simpleman  
       2025 年 2 月 20 日
    有点资产的话, 让小孩经济学/金融更好
    loryyang
        20
    loryyang  
       2025 年 2 月 20 日
    如果有兴趣可以学啊,但我觉得,先把数学学好更重要
    Lisa9527
        21
    Lisa9527  
       2025 年 2 月 20 日   1
    这个东西,感觉还是家庭氛围会有影响,如果你自己鼓捣硬件,孩子也会跟着喜欢
    xdzhang
        22
    xdzhang  
       2025 年 2 月 20 日
    你写了一辈子代码现在腰不痛吗。。。
    BBrother
        23
    BBrother  
       2025 年 2 月 20 日
    1. 首先不要拿萝卜钓鱼
    2. 现在已经不是上个世纪整点命令行和输入输出和 pygame 就能带来成就感的年代了,现在小朋友会觉得自己花大力气整出来的 pygame 游戏就是个垃圾
    3. 上 steam 找找编程小游戏入门应该还行,比如 70 亿人、我的世界之类的
    zlkent
        24
    zlkent  
    PRO
       2025 年 2 月 20 日   2
    @Lisa9527 #21 是的,我就是经常捣鼓硬件,我家娃 3 岁开始就一直很有兴趣,现在 5 岁了,很喜欢研究东西,前阵子给他玩了 code.org 上的编程,欲罢不能,虽然他不知道自己在干啥。
    在我看来,学编程只是教会他一个能快速解决生活或者工作上遇到问题的能力,并不指望他去靠这个吃饭。
    gpt5
        25
    gpt5  
       2025 年 2 月 20 日   2
    很多人对课外学东西有 ptsd 。
    我 8/9 岁开始学的编程,我认为受益非常大。
    csuzhangxc
        26
    csuzhangxc  
       2025 年 2 月 20 日 via Android
    小孩有很大表达欲(大人也是吧),如果编程这个工具能帮他们表达出来,他们成就感就很大
    b1u2g3
        27
    b1u2g3  
       2025 年 2 月 20 日
    请不要拿拙劣的商业编程禁锢孩子好么
    这个年纪,探索的大好时光,多看看别的不好么
    levelworm
        28
    levelworm  
       2025 年 2 月 20 日 via Android
    @zlkent #24
    太赞了,坛贤捣鼓什么硬件? Wozniak 也说他从小就看他爸在家捣鼓电子电路,于是很小就喜欢搞。但是我觉得写程序的话,就不是很适合,因为小孩不能长时间看屏幕。
    lekai63
        29
    lekai63  
       2025 年 2 月 20 日 via iPhone
    @levelworm 原话大体是:那十怎么表示呢。

    小学生有基本的思维能力了。 跟幼儿园不小的差别的。
    lekai63
        30
    lekai63  
       2025 年 2 月 20 日 via iPhone
    @zlkent 感谢。带娃试试 code.org
    zlkent
        31
    zlkent  
    PRO
       2025 年 2 月 20 日   1
    @levelworm #28 我自己是软件产品,但喜欢修修东西,比如手机电脑什么的,也会网上找一些好玩的 diy 的硬件自己照着做,家里去年也买了 3d 打印机,所以娃一直耳濡目染。我们家也是一直严控屏幕使用,但我动手的时候娃就很喜欢在旁边看,自己也想上手,也喜欢模仿。
    mumbler
        32
    mumbler  
       2025 年 2 月 20 日
    教操作电脑,会用鼠标,会安装软件,会用 office 编辑文档,会用 PS 改图片
    这些技能远比编程要重要且高频得多,编程在 AI 时代有不同的模式,过去的学习方法都肯定无效了
    heybuddy
        33
    heybuddy  
       2025 年 2 月 20 日 via Android
    现在中小学信息教材都改版了,更多的以思维训练为主,在初中也是以图形化编程为主的
    momo65535
        34
    momo65535  
       2025 年 2 月 20 日
    试试 while True: learn()
    brianinzz
        35
    brianinzz  
       2025 年 2 月 20 日
    今年打算让孩儿玩我的世界...问题是我都没玩过,不知道让他从何玩起...玩创造模式 自己建建房子?
    csuzhangxc
        36
    csuzhangxc  
       2025 年 2 月 20 日
    一个外国学生做的视频

    I Spent 6 Years Making Games in Scratch:


    编程不只是牛马的日常搬砖,学习也不一定就是枯燥无味
    levelworm
        37
    levelworm  
       2025 年 2 月 20 日
    @zlkent #31
    Thanks!
    关于     帮助文档     自助推广系统     博客     API     FAQ     Solana     1256 人在线   最高记录 6679       Select Language
    创意工作者们的社区
    World is powered by solitude
    VERSION: 3.9.8.5 27ms UTC 17:35 PVG 01:35 LAX 09:35 JFK 12:35
    Do have faith in what you're doing.
    ubao msn snddm index pchome yahoo rakuten mypaper meadowduck bidyahoo youbao zxmzxm asda bnvcg cvbfg dfscv mmhjk xxddc yybgb zznbn ccubao uaitu acv GXCV ET GDG YH FG BCVB FJFH CBRE CBC GDG ET54 WRWR RWER WREW WRWER RWER SDG EW SF DSFSF fbbs ubao fhd dfg ewr dg df ewwr ewwr et ruyut utut dfg fgd gdfgt etg dfgt dfgd ert4 gd fgg wr 235 wer3 we vsdf sdf gdf ert xcv sdf rwer hfd dfg cvb rwf afb dfh jgh bmn lgh rty gfds cxv xcv xcs vdas fdf fgd cv sdf tert s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f shasha9178 shasha9178 shasha9178 shasha9178 shasha9178 liflif2 liflif2 liflif2 liflif2 liflif2 liblib3 liblib3 liblib3 liblib3 liblib3 zhazha444 zhazha444 zhazha444 zhazha444 zhazha444 dende5 dende denden denden2 denden21 fenfen9 fenf619 fen619 fenfe9 fe619 sdf sdf sdf sdf sdf zhazh90 zhazh0 zhaa50 zha90 zh590 zho zhoz zhozh zhozho zhozho2 lislis lls95 lili95 lils5 liss9 sdf0ty987 sdft876 sdft9876 sdf09876 sd0t9876 sdf0ty98 sdf0976 sdf0ty986 sdf0ty96 sdf0t76 sdf0876 df0ty98 sf0t876 sd0ty76 sdy76 sdf76 sdf0t76 sdf0ty9 sdf0ty98 sdf0ty987 sdf0ty98 sdf6676 sdf876 sd876 sd876 sdf6 sdf6 sdf9876 sdf0t sdf06 sdf0ty9776 sdf0ty9776 sdf0ty76 sdf8876 sdf0t sd6 sdf06 s688876 sd688 sdf86